After listing the additional shares tomorrow (subject to the LSE of course), there will be 80m shares issues (55m + 25m).

The mid price at present is 13.25 (12.5/14.0) giving a market value of 10.6m.

The P/E for various samples of retained profits (EAT) to be reported Q1 2004 but for the period 1/1/2003 to 31/12/2003 are as follows:

EAT P/E
=== ===
100k -> 106
250k -> 42
400k -> 27
750k -> 14

For a share price of say 25p

EAT P/E
=== ===
100k -> 200
250k -> 80
400k -> 50
750k -> 27

For a share price of say 50p

EAT P/E
=== ===
100k -> 400
250k -> 160
400k -> 100
750k -> 53

From the above, and looking at other small caps 25p+ is not unrealistic if they make 250k EAT for this FY.

So long as there continues to be an accelerating sales and profit story, high P/Es will be maintained which means the share price will rise. CWV have got the cash to take advantage of the new market data opportunities. Whilst large incumbents seem to be struggling there is plenty of room for small, flexible, innovative organisations to make an impact. Very good news for the prospects for CVW in 2004.
